Overview
MP3302DJ-LF-Z from Monolithic Power Systems is a 40V, 1.3A single-cell step-up white LED driver with fixed-frequency current-mode control, 200mV feedback voltage, and single-wire analog/PWM dimming. It integrates a 0.5Ω internal MOSFET switch and regulates LED current via external sense resistor for up to 10-series WLED strings in handheld LCD backlighting.
For engineers reviewing the MP3302DJ-LF-Z datasheet, MP3302DJ-LF-Z pinout, MP3302DJ-LF-Z application, or MP3302DJ-LF-Z equivalent, key selection criteria include its 1.3MHz switching frequency, open-load shutdown at 42V, thermal shutdown at 150°C, UVLO (2.45V rising), and compatibility with TSOT23-5 footprint for space-constrained portable designs.
Technical Context
The MP3302DJ-LF-Z implements a constant-frequency peak-current-mode boost converter architecture with internal ramp compensation to suppress subharmonic oscillation above 50% duty cycle. Its error amplifier compares FB voltage against a trimmed 200mV reference to regulate LED current.
Dimming is implemented through EN pin: DC voltage (0.7–1.4V) enables analog dimming by scaling FB reference linearly from 0–200mV; PWM signals (200Hz–1kHz, ≥1.5V amplitude) provide digital brightness control. Open-circuit protection disables SW when VOUT exceeds 42V.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| Input Voltage Range | 2.5V to 6V - supports single Li-ion battery operation without overvoltage stress on internal circuitry |
| Switching Frequency | 1.3MHz (typ) - enables use of small 4.7µH inductors and 0.47µF output capacitors in compact layouts |
| Feedback Voltage | 200mV (typ) - reduces I²R loss across sense resistor, improving efficiency at high LED currents |
| SW Pin Max Voltage | 36V - defines maximum achievable LED string voltage (e.g., 10×3.3V WLEDs = 33V) |
| Thermal Shutdown | 150°C - protects die during sustained overload or poor PCB thermal design |
| UVLO Threshold | 2.45V (rising) - prevents erratic startup below usable battery voltage, ensuring stable regulation |
| Open-Load Shutdown | 42V (rising) - disables switching if LED string opens, preventing uncontrolled voltage rise and capacitor overstress |
Pinout & Package
MP3302DJ-LF-Z is packaged in a 5-pin TSOT23-5 with exposed pad connected to GND for thermal dissipation. The package measures 2.9mm × 1.6mm × 0.85mm and is RoHS-compliant.
| Pin |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| SW | Drain of internal 0.5Ω MOSFET - connects to inductor and rectifier; swings from GND to ≤36V |
| 2 | GND | Power and signal ground - must be tied to exposed pad for thermal performance and noise immunity |
| 3 | FB | Current-sense feedback input - regulates LED current by holding voltage across RSENSE at 200mV |
| 4 | EN | Enable/dimming control - logic-level ON/OFF and analog/PWM dimming interface (0.4V/0.6V thresholds) |
| 5 | IN | Input supply pin - requires local 10µF ceramic bypass capacitor to minimize high-frequency ripple |

FAQ
What is the maximum number of white LEDs the MP3302DJ-LF-Z can drive in series?
The MP3302DJ-LF-Z supports up to 10 white LEDs in series, assuming typical forward voltage of 3.3V per LED (33V total), staying within its 36V SW pin rating and 42V open-load shutdown threshold. Driving more than 10 LEDs risks exceeding safe operating voltage limits and triggering protection shutdown.
Does the MP3302DJ-LF-Z require an external Schottky diode?
Yes - the MP3302DJ-LF-Z requires an external Schottky diode (e.g., B0540) connected between SW and the LED string anode. The internal MOSFET serves only as the high-side switch; the diode provides the return path for inductor current during off-time, enabling boost topology operation.
How is LED current set, and what tolerance applies to the 200mV feedback voltage?
LED current is set by ILED = 200mV / RSENSE, using a precision resistor from FB to GND. The feedback voltage is specified as 185–215mV (±15mV) over temperature and process, yielding ±7.5% current accuracy before considering resistor tolerance and layout parasitics.
Can the MP3302DJ-LF-Z operate from a 3.3V input while driving 9 strings of 3-series LEDs?
Yes - the MP3302DJ-LF-Z operates from 2.5V to 6V input. With 9 parallel strings of 3×3.3V WLEDs (≈10V string voltage), the boost converter delivers ~180mA total current at >80% efficiency from 3.3V input, as verified in Figure 2 of the datasheet under "Typical Application."
What thermal derating applies to the TSOT23-5 package at 85°C ambient?
With θJA = 220°C/W and TJ(MAX) = 125°C, maximum continuous power dissipation at TA = 85°C is (125 − 85)/220 ≈ 0.18W. At typical 87% efficiency and 180mA LED load, power dissipation remains ~0.12W - within safe margin without forced airflow or copper pour enhancement.
Is the EN pin compatible with 1.8V or 3.3V GPIO control without level shifting?
Yes - the EN pin has guaranteed turn-on at ≥0.6V and turn-off at ≤0.4V, making it directly compatible with 1.8V and 3.3V CMOS GPIO outputs. For analog dimming, ensure the driving DAC or resistor divider provides clean 0.7–1.4V with local 100nF bypassing to avoid noise-induced current instability.
